Kartikay Verma Verified Icon
B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ering (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ning) - Batch of 2028
3.8
3Placements4Infrastructure4Faculty3Crowd & Campus Life5Value for Money
Lingayas Vidyapeeth- value for money.
Placements: 30% of students were placed from my course at campus placements, with the highest package being 13 LPA and the average being 4 LPA. Top recruiting companies are IBM and Wipro. Over 60% of students got internships with stipends, and some were unpaid too. Top roles were web developer.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ure in our department is quite nice. We have a lot of labs. The library of the university is very big, having more than 125,000 accessible books. The quality of food in the canteen is nice, but in the mess, the food is average. The hostel is neat and clean, having all basic requirements.
Faculty: Most of the teachers have completed their Ph.D. and are well-trained and knowledgeable. All the classrooms are equipped with smart boards and projectors. The course curriculum is relevant. Seminars and hackathons are conducted to make students industry-ready and boost their confidence. Exams are conducted every 3 months, i.e., two times in a semester, and are quite average. The pass percentage is 70%.
Other: I chose this course as I was interested in this field. Every year, the annual cultural fest "ZEST" takes place in October and is for 2 days. I got a 40% scholarship on tuition fees for the first year as I scored 80% marks in the CBSE board exam. The crowd is quite average.

Pari Sharma Verified Icon
B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ering (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ning) - Batch of 2027
4.2
3Placements3Infrastructure5Faculty5Crowd & Campus Life5Value for Money
Lingayas vidyapeeth - The best private college in Faridabad.
Placements: Our college is providing average placement. The highest package offered this year was 32 LPA and the average was 8 LPA and the top recruitment company was TCS and a total of 60% of students got internships from our course with companies like Infosys, TCS, Wipro, and Oracle and 10% got placed.
Infrastructure: In our department, there are plenty of labs and even a digital library is available in our block and the infrastructure is average, not so good, not so bad and the building is also average. The problem is there is no Wi-Fi in our college, even not in the computer block.
Faculty: Faculty are so cooperative and overall the experience with faculty is good so far. The course curriculum is so relevant to the course. The semester exams are average, not hard, not so easy and teachers are so helpful and the passing percentage is about 85%.
Other: In this college, so many events take place and the seniors here are superb.

Manish Kumar Verified Icon
B.Sc. (Hons.) in Chemistry - Batch of 2021
3.2
2Placements4Infrastructure3Faculty4Crowd & Campus Life3Value for Money
The campus and hostel life are awesome; you can just go through this college.
Placements: There is no placement offered by companies, but yes, there were a lot of internship opportunities provided regarding your subject. HOD provided contact to their senior professors, where you can go through your internship on the basis of your interview skills.
Infrastructure: Classroom space and seats are enough for study, but the boards are not smart boards; they use simple green boards and write with the help of chalk. On the other hand, the library is just an awesome experience. Most of the time, I spend in the library for my study environment. Hostel life is also good; for girls, security is also available, and other facilities are provided for survival.
Faculty: The faculty in this college are average. Some teachers are very good, but some teachers are not good due to a lack of practical knowledge. However, the Head of the Department was very good for guidance and the best for study. There were internal exams as well as external exams; the level of exam was moderate.
Other: I chose B.Sc. Chemistry Honours from this college on the basis of an exam. I did not find a college that provides a B.Sc. Honours in Chemistry. The lab assistant was a very humble and good person. He helped me to improve my skills. Campus life is just awesome, and the canteen is good.

Lingaya’s Vidyapeeth Cutoff FAQs

Q:   How are Lingaya's Vidyapeeth 2023 cut off marks determined?

A: 

The Lingaya's Vidyapeeth 2023 cutoff marks are influenced by several key factors:

  • Number of Candidates: The cutoff marks are significantly impacted by the total number of candidates taking the exam. Higher candidate numbers can result in higher cutoff marks, and vice versa.
  • Exam Difficulty: The difficulty level of the examination itself is another critical factor in determining the cutoff marks. A more challenging exam can lead to lower cutoff marks, while an easier exam may result in higher cutoff marks.
  • Available Seats: The cutoff marks are also influenced by the availability of seats in the college. Fewer available seats can lead to higher cutoff marks, whereas a surplus of seats may result in lower cutoff marks.
  • Previous Year's Trends: The cutoff marks are partially determined by the trends in cutoff scores from previous years. Higher cutoffs in previous years can contribute to higher cutoff marks in the current year, and lower previous cutoffs may lead to lower current cutoffs.

Q:   Can I get into Lingaya's Vidyapeeth with 70%?

A: 

Certainly, you can secure admission to Lingaya's Vidyapeeth with 70%. The eligibility criteria for admission to Lingaya's Vidyapeeth for the academic year 2023-24 are as follows:

  1. The student should have passed Class 12th with a minimum of 60% marks.
  2. The candidate should obtain at least a score of 60% in the qualifying examination.
  3. The candidate should have successfully completed the 10+2 examination from a recognised state or central board with a minimum of 55% marks in physics, chemistry, and English, along with mathematics or biology or an equivalent qualification.
  4. Moreover, Lingaya's Vidyapeeth offers a scholarship programme for candidates who score between 60% to 70%, providing a 15% scholarship on tuition fees for the first year.
